What is the inverse of the logarithmic function

f(x) = log gX

Answer:

An exponential function. [tex]f(y) = g^{y}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

The inverse of the logarithmic function is an exponential function.

[tex]f(x) = \log_{g} x[/tex]

[tex]g^{f(x)} = x[/tex]

[tex]g^{y} = f(y)[/tex]

[tex]f(y) = g^{y}[/tex]
